description We have characterized the 60 table grape accessions preserved at the living collection of the Domaine Expérimental de Ain Taoujdate (Morocco) through DNA analyses. Genetic profiling based on 13 SSRs and 240 SNP markers identified up to 40 different genotypes, denoting a certain level of redundancy. This information was useful to detect many cases of misspelled accessions, some misnamed varieties, and several potential new synonymies. The comparison of these genetic profiles with international databases led to the identification of 58 accessions as 38 table grape varieties, half of them corresponding to obtentions bred in recent programs of table grape improvement. Only two accessions (named "Diamant Noir" and "Sultanine Rosée") did not match any known genetic profile. We found that "Sultanine Rosée" does not correspond to 'Kishmish Rozovyi', the described pink-berried variant of 'Sultanina'. Indeed, it turned out to be a grape variety not catalogued in international genetic databases that arose from the cross between 'Sultanina' and 'Fokiano', which we suggest to name 'Sultanine Rose Faux'. Besides, the duo detected between the accession "Diamant Noir" and the variety 'Moscato D'Adda' suggests that it might correspond to the table grape variety named 'Diamante Nero' ('Pirovano 57' × 'Moscato D'Adda'). We proved that molecular-assisted parentage analyses could be an efficient approach to suggest an identity for grapevine varieties that lack a matching genotype in international catalogues.
